How to Choose a Currency Broker

A currency broker can be described as a company that trades foreign currencies. They provide access to the forex market, making it easier for individuals and businesses to trade currency pairs.

A few things to consider when choosing a forex brokerage include the regulatory status of the firm, the types of currency pairs offered, and the commission charges that the brokerage charges for trades.

Brokers will generally charge a spread, or commission, for trades they facilitate for clients. This is usually taken from your leveraged trade rather than your account balance. You should avoid excessive spreads as they can make your trade less attractive, and could lead to you losing more money.

If you are new to forex trading, it is crucial that you understand the spreads and the different lot sizes. A lot is the smallest trade size that a broker allows, and it can vary by broker. Many forex brokers offer micro lots and mini lots that are smaller than the standard 100k lots. These smaller sizes mean fewer pips needed to break even or earn a profit on the trade.


The spreads are determined by the broker and can vary widely, depending on how many traders are trading in a given currency pair at a particular time. Because of the potential for significant losses, choosing a forex broker with competitive commissions and low spreads is a good idea.

You should also check if the broker registered with a reputable regulator agency like the Commodity Futures Trading Commission. If a broker is not properly registered, it could be fraudulent or not meet a variety of legal and regulatory requirements.

Also, make sure you choose a broker that is local and speaks your language. A broker who has a local office is a good choice if you are a South African citizen.

You should also check the speed and efficiency with which withdrawals and deposits are processed. This is particularly important for ZAR accounts as you don’t want to pay conversion fees or wait too long to withdraw funds.

A currency broker is essential for trading in South Africa, or any other country. It can mean the difference between a small profit and a large loss. These brokers must be able offer reliable resources, low trading fees and access to the global interbank system. They should be able handle your money with care.

Are forex traders able to make a living?

Yes, forex traders can earn money. While it is possible to achieve success in the short-term, long-term profits typically come from dedication and a willingness to learn. More traders who are able to understand the market and can analyze technical issues will be successful than those who rely on luck or guesswork.

It's not easy to trade forex, but it is possible with the right knowledge strategies to produce consistent profits over time. It is important to find an educated mentor and develop a working knowledge of risk management before risking real capital.

Many traders lose their money because they don't have a well-planned strategy or plan. But with discipline, you can maximize your chances of making a profit in foreign exchange markets.

Forex traders who are experienced create trading plans to help them reduce their risk exposure while still finding lucrative opportunities. Risk management is key; many new traders can become too aggressive by chasing quick gains instead of having a consistent long-term strategy.

Forex traders can increase their chance of generating long-term profits by maintaining good records, learning past trades and paying attention to other aspects of trading.

Forex trading requires discipline. You need to establish rules that limit your losses. Leverage entry signals and other strategies can increase profits.

Be persistent, learn from successful day trader and be persistent. Profitability in the forex market trading markets is dependent on whether you're managing funds for yourself or someone else.

How can I ensure the security of my online investment account?

Safety is a must when it comes to online investment accounts. It is crucial to safeguard your data and assets against unwelcome intrusions.

You must first ensure that the platform you're using has security. Look for encryption technology, two-factor authentication, and other security measures that will provide maximum protection against potential hackers or malicious actors. It is also important to have a policy that details how any personal data you share with them will regulated and monitored.

Secondly, always choose strong passwords for account access and limit your log in sessions on public networks. Avoid clicking suspicious links or downloading unfamiliar software--these can lead to malicious downloads and ultimate compromises of your funds. You should also regularly review your account activity to ensure you are aware of any suspicious links or downloading unfamiliar software. This will allow you to quickly detect possible threats and take appropriate action.

It is important to be familiar with the terms and conditions of any online investment platform. Be aware of the fees involved in investing and any restrictions on how you may use your account.

Fourth, be sure to research the company where you plan on investing. To get a better idea of the platform's functionality and user feedback, you can look at ratings and reviews. Finally, you should be aware of tax implications for investing online.

Follow these steps to ensure your online account is protected from potential threats.
